首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MySQL数据库对象视图理解

概述 在MySQL中,除了表之外,还有许多其他数据库对象视图。这些对象允许我们组织和管理数据,以及提供一种可读性更好和易于理解方式来查询数据。...在本文中,我们将深入了解MySQL中数据库对象视图,并提供一些示例。 数据库对象 索引 索引是一种特殊数据结构,它允许我们更快地访问表中数据。...视图 视图是一种虚拟表,它从一个或多个现有表中派生而来。视图本身并不存储数据,而是通过查询底层表来返回结果。...视图在MySQL中非常有用,因为它们可以简化查询,并提供一种可读性更好和易于理解方式来查询数据。...employees.department_id = departments.id JOIN salaries ON employees.id = salaries.employee_id; 这将创建一个名为employee_details视图

87320
您找到你想要的搜索结果了吗?
是的
没有找到

在spring项目里面,通过上下文类ApplicationContext 获取到我们想要bean对象,而不是注解获取

目录 1 问题 2 写一个工具类 3 使用工具类 1 问题 我们spring项目,一般bean对象创建,就是靠注解,但是我现在想要在代码里面,不是使用注解获取到bean对象,而是在上下文对象里面获取到...bean对象,我们都知道,我们项目一起动,就扫描注解,让被注解类,创建bean对象,放到spring容器里面,之后就是从容器里面获取对象,所以获取时候,我们就可以这样获取 2 写一个工具类 import...Component public class ApplicationContextUtils implements ApplicationContextAware { /** * 上下文对象实例...clazz) { return getApplicationContext().getBean(clazz); } /** * 通过name,以及Clazz返回指定Bean...singleController = applicationContext.getBean("eeeController"); System.out.println(singleController); 以上就可以获取到我们想要对象

1.2K10

Thinkphp5框架实现获取数据库数据到视图方法

本文实例讲述了Thinkphp5框架实现获取数据库数据到视图方法。分享给大家供大家参考,具体如下: 这是学习thinkhp5基础篇笔记。...这里主要讲怎么配置数据库链接,以及查询数据库数据,并且最后将数据赋给视图数据库配置: thinkphp5数据库配置默认在conf下database.php下面。我数据库配置项目如下 <?...配置之后就可以使用tp5查询语句查询数据库了。 查询数据库数据阶段,使用了tp5模型类,这样就可以直接利用tp5自带数据库查询方法,下面是model代码 <?...tp5操作数据库可以有2种方法,具体又分3种方法,两种是使用Db类和继承数据库模型;三种是Db下可以使用tp查询也可以使用原生查询。...关于tp5操控数据库有很多方法,这里只是记录下查询数据库基本操作实现。

1.2K10

PostgreSQL 使用递归SQL 找出数据库对象之间依赖关系 - 例如视图依赖

背景: 在数据库对象对象之间存在一定依赖关系,例如继承表之间依赖,视图与基表依赖,主外键依赖,序列依赖等等。...在删除对象时,数据库也会先检测依赖,如果有依赖,会报错,需要使用cascade删除。 另外一方面,如果需要重建表,使用重命名方式是有一定风险,例如依赖关系没有迁移,仅仅迁移了表是不够。...select * from get_dep_oids('sm1.v1'::regclass); get_dep_oids ────────────── {24971} (1 row) 再创建一个函数,递归得到依赖对象...3个视图,分别是public schema下 v1 和 v2 视图、sm1 schema下v1 视图。...获取视图定义 14:41:21 db: postgres@postgres, pid:54661 =# select * from pg_get_viewdef('v1',false);

1.3K40

小程序云开发实战五:如何将获取API数据存入云数据库里面

之前文章里面已经详细写过像云数据库里面插入数据方法,现在用在实际项目里面再写一遍。...1:使用数据库时候,首先要进行初始化 云开发数据库文档: https://developers.weixin.qq.com/miniprogram/dev/wxcloud/guide/database...,拿到barCode代码 3:将拿到barCode代码传递给云函数中bookinfo,传递后将结果获取到本地 4:用云数据库示例去创建新字段添加到数据库之中 6:测试一下,好了,小程序端获取豆瓣...API数据存入云数据库里面了。...附上: 主要思路: 1:通过调用小程序扫码api 2:调用云函数获取到图书信息,并将图书信息传递到小程序 3:在小程序中 调用云数据库来添加 可能会有很多人有问,为啥不直接在云函数中完成添加?

1.1K30

小程序云开发实战五:如何将获取API数据存入云数据库里面

之前文章里面已经详细写过像云数据库里面插入数据方法,现在用在实际项目里面再写一遍。...1:使用数据库时候,首先要进行初始化 云开发数据库文档: https://developers.weixin.qq.com/miniprogram/dev/wxcloud/guide/database...,拿到barCode代码 3:将拿到barCode代码传递给云函数中bookinfo,传递后将结果获取到本地 4:用云数据库示例去创建新字段添加到数据库之中 6:测试一下,好了,小程序端获取豆瓣...API数据存入云数据库里面了。...附上: 主要思路: 1:通过调用小程序扫码api 2:调用云函数获取到图书信息,并将图书信息传递到小程序 3:在小程序中 调用云数据库来添加 可能会有很多人有问,为啥不直接在云函数中完成添加?

3.4K20

ES6(四)用Promise封装一下IndexedDB 配置文件内部成员建立对象库以及打开数据库初始化对象添加对象修改对象删除对象清空仓库里对象删除对象仓库删除数据库按主键获取对象

这个就非常简单了,不用判断是否打开数据库,直接删除就好。 不过前端数据库应该具备这样功能:整个库删掉后,可以自动恢复状态才行。 按主键获取对象,或者获取全部 /** * 获取对象。...* storeName:对象仓库名; * id:要获取对象key值,注意类型要准确,只能取一个。...获取对象仓库里所有对象 不想取两个函数名,于是就依据参数来区分了,传递ID就获取ID对象,没有传递ID就返回全部。...建立对象库 dbOpen().then(() =>{ // 建表初始化之后,获取全部对象 getAll() }) dbOpen 打开数据库,同时判断是否需要建立数据库,如果需要的话,会根据配置信息自动建立数据库...然后我们按F12,打开Application标签,可以找到我们建立数据库,如图: ?

2.1K20

实时音视频开发学习13 - 小程序端API

视图控制 视图控制主要用于全屏开启与关闭、设定远端画面显示方向和填充模式、显示或隐藏某一路视频画面、设定视频画面左边和尺寸以及制定视频画面的层级。视图操控让语音通话变得更加人性化。...我们在调试时候可以给按钮绑定一个事件监听,并命名一个判断标志isShowFullScreen,默认为false。...该属性提供两种填充方式完整显示画面contain和铺满视图fillCrop。 使用场景也是在进入房间后对画面的显示方式作出选择,在这里,我们还可以根据用户ID不同给与不一样填充方式。...sendGroupCustomMessage发送自定义群消息,和发送自定义消息类似,只不过将属性换成了roomID,也需要传递一个payload对象,切该对象属性也和自定义消息payload一样。...事件表 对组件对象使用on进行事件监听,并绑定EVENT属性获取到对应状态,并进行相关业务逻辑。常用有进出房事件、远端用户进出房和远端音视频流加载与移除等事件。

1.2K40

ASP.NET MVC学习笔记04数据传递

上一篇末尾讲到了,在了解模型之前,先来看看ASP.NET MVC是如何将数据从控制器传递给视图。...最理想模式下:一个视图模板应该永远不会执行业务逻辑或者直接和数据库进行交互。相应,一个视图模板应该只和控制器所提供数据进行交互。...比如,最开始控制器讲解时HelloController类中Welcome方法从浏览器获取一个name和numTimes参数,然后直接输出。...模型绑定(model binder) 使得数据从URL传递给控制器。控制器将数据装入到ViewBag对象中,通过该对象传递给视图。然后视图为用户生成显示所需HTML。...到这里,这是一种”M”模型,但不是数据库那种“M”模型。 下一篇,开始正式讲解基于数据模型和模型类来实现M——Model.

2.4K60

Science重磅:无需标注数据,DeepMind新研究让机器“脑补”立体世界!

一个计算机视觉系统可以从其他任意视点几个2D视图中,预测一个3D场景。...当涉及到我们如何理解一个视觉场景时,我们眼睛所能看到不仅仅是直观视觉,因为我们大脑会运用头脑中储备知识,将感性认识转化成理性认识。...当前,最先进视觉识别系统都是用人类产生带注释图像大数据集来训练获取这些数据是一个代价高昂且耗时过程,需要每个人对数据集中每个场景中每个对象进行标记。...表征网络无法获知,生成网络将被要求预测哪些视角,因此,它必须尽可能准确地找到描述场景真实布局有效方式。 通过简洁分布式表征,其可以捕获最重要特征(如对象位置、颜色和房间布局)来实现此目的。...例如,表示网络将简洁地将“蓝色立方体”表示为一小组数字,而生成网络将知道如何将其自身表现为来自特定视点像素。

51230

vue面试题总结

【重点】vue底层原理实现(双向数据绑定原理实现)? Vue是一个典型MVVM框架,模型(Model)只是普通JavaScript对象,修改它则视图(View)会自动更新。...()通知watcher,派发更新,并且触发compile中绑定回调,渲染视图== ==长话短说:劫持数据,创建def通知watcher,触发回调,更新数据,渲染视图== ==一个属性对象多个dep...v-model通常用于表单组件绑定,表单组件双向绑定 v-text用于操作纯文本,单向绑定,数据变化->插值跟着变化,但插值变化不会影响数据对象值 3. 【重点】Vue生命周期方法有哪些?...【重点】对template模板编译理解 问题核心:如何将template转换成render函数 ?...监听房间切换来显示对应房间预约记录 10.

25610

ARKit 配置-在您AR项目的幕后

在本节中,我们将看看如何在后面配置提供ARKit模板。我们将发现什么是世界跟踪和AR会话。同样,我们将学习如何将一些调试选项应用于场景中指导。...您可以通过添加标签,按钮和其他对象对象来自定义此视图,并轻松编辑其属性而无需触及代码。您还可以添加其他视图并管理它们之间链接。基本上,故事板是设计师最好朋友。...如果您想了解更多这整个屏幕,可有两个部分在谈论它书,Xcode 9 简介和Storyboad 简介。 AR场景视图 ARKit模板已经放入对象库中可用ARSCNView视图类中。...没有它,我们将无法跟踪我们设备在世界上位置,将我们虚拟对象放在桌子上,甚至放在房间里。...这些是特征点,它们是相机感知物体显着特征。例如,如果你看看我桌子,你会发现它们很少。但是如果你切换到我键盘,你可以真正看到键和它上面的字符之间区别。

2.5K20

分房管理系统Rose模型设计过程

文章目录 一、模型总体设计 1 创建系统Use Case 视图 2 创建系统 Logical 视图 3 创建系统 Class 框图 4 创建系统 StateChart 框图 5 创建系统 Activity...四、数据库设计 1 软件数据流图设计 2 软件系统数据字典 五、后言 ---- 一、模型总体设计 1 创建系统Use Case 视图 Use Case框图显示系统中使用案例与角色及其相互关系,角色是与所建系统交互对象...DBUser是需要对Manger进行数据库处理数据库操作类。根据Manger类需求进行重写DBUtil接口方法。 图1.8 图1.9是系统根据‘老板’所需要操作对象进行制作class框图。...第一种就是无需排队,也就是说此时有空闲房子;第二种就是需要排队,并且每隔一段时间重复刷新值,直到有空闲房间可以入住。 图1.11展示了在房间有人住情况下进行换房申请申请状态对象图。...先验证输入房屋信息格式和内容是否有误,如果有误则将继续输入,否则进入下一层,获取验证码,然后输入验证码,验证码如果输入错误则需要重新输入,否则进入数据库接口,修改房屋文件。

81830

SpringMVC架构有什么优势?——控制器(一)

该方法通过调用userServicegetUserById()方法来获取用户信息,并将结果添加到ModelAndView对象中,然后将返回视图名称设置为"user"。 2....参数绑定(Request Parameters Binding): 参数绑定指定如何将HTTP请求参数绑定到控制器处理方法参数上。...@RequestBody注解告诉Spring将HTTP请求正文中数据绑定到User对象上。 4. 视图解析器(View Resolver): 视图解析器负责将逻辑视图名称解析为实际视图实现。...以上就是Spring MVC控制器核心概念和相应Java代码示例详细解释。 5. 数据绑定(Data Binding): 数据绑定是将表单参数绑定到Java对象属性上过程。...通过以上介绍,我们可以看出,Spring MVC控制器包含了多个重要组件,包括控制器、请求映射、参数绑定视图解析器、数据绑定、表单验证和异常处理等。

5310
领券